<div class='os_post_top_link'><a href='http://www.electronista.com/articles/11/07/27/streamlines.minimizes.content/' target='_blank'>http://www.electronista.com/article...imizes.content/</a><br /><br /></div><p><em>"Google has begun testing a new, tablet-oriented version of its search page, reports say. To cope with the limitations of tablets, content has been funneled into a single column. Sidebar options have been moved under the search field, and the "Goooooooooogle" text at the bottom of the site now just shows page numbers from one to 10."</em></p><p><img height="520" src="http://images.thoughtsmedia.com/resizer/thumbs/size/600/at/auto/1311814402.usr105634.jpg" style="border: 1px solid #d2d2bb; margin-left: 50px; margin-right: 50px;" width="500" /></p><p>This is only in use for a small percentage of users, randomly chosen from what the article says.
